Location: Woodhead Fyvie House size: 200m2 Project cost: £260,000 Construction method: Structural insulated panels (SIPs) Style of house: Contemporary Design & supply: Caber House
Sarah and John Stupart have recently completed construction of their new self build home using structural insulated panels (SIPs). After finding a stunning site on the edge of open countryside near Fyvie in Scotland, they explored options for how to achieve their goal. “We set out with the aim for a lowmaintenance, low-energy house with a sleek modern look that was easy to live in,” says Sarah. After ample research, they selected a Caber House model Type B. The Stuparts personalised the design by altering the internal layout, adding a ground floor master suite, utility and pantry, plus a large sunroom to capture the surrounding views.
